CM gives Maha sports awards

    Mumbai, Feb 22 (PTI) Maharashtra Chief Minister Uddhav
Thackrey on Saturday presented the state sports awards to the
winners at a glittering ceremony here.
    The Maharashtra government had announced the Shiv
Chhatrapati award for 44 sportspersons apart from a lifetime
achievement award and awards to sportspersons in the adventure
category.
    "Thackeray presented the Shiv Chhatrapati Awards at
the Gateway of India for 2018-19. At the function, the medal
winners of the Khelo India Youth Games were too felicitated,"
the Chief Minister's Office (CMO) tweeted.
    Among the award winners were Kabaddi player Rishank
Devadiga, wrestler Abhijit Katke and hockey player Akash
Chikte.
    State Tourism Minister Aaditya Thackeray, Sports
Minister Sunil Kedar and top officials from the sports
department were present.
    "This evening, I was present at the Gateway of India
to honour Maharashtra's sportspersons at the hands of Hon'ble
CM Uddhav Thackeray ji," tweeted Aaditya.
    "The Shiv Chhatrapati Puraskar (Award) ceremony had
not been held for 3 years, sports was being ignored. Not
anymore," Aaditya said in another tweet. PTI NRB
